    Micah Parsons ACL Surgery Recovery Update

    Green Bay Packers linebacker Micah Parsons has shared a positive update following his ACL surgery. The star player confirmed that the operation was successful and that he is now starting his recovery journey. Fans and teammates are hopeful for his return in the 2026 season.

    Parsons suffered a major knee injury earlier this year, which led to the decision to undergo surgery. ACL injuries are serious for football players, often requiring several months of rehabilitation before returning to full action. The linebacker’s team has expressed support and optimism as he begins the road to recovery.

    Micah Parsons has been a key figure for the Packers since joining the team. Known for his speed, strength, and playmaking ability, he has made a significant impact on the defensive line. His absence this season has been felt, but the positive surgery update brings relief to the team and fans alike.

    Recovery from ACL surgery involves a careful balance of rest, physical therapy, and gradual strength training. Specialists often recommend a timeline of nine to twelve months before athletes return to competitive play. Parsons’ update indicates that he is progressing well and following medical guidance closely.

    The linebacker took to social media to reassure fans. He thanked his medical team and shared that he is committed to working hard every day to regain full fitness. His message emphasized determination and focus, inspiring hope among supporters.

    Parsons’ performance prior to the injury was exceptional. He has consistently ranked among the league’s top defensive players, recording tackles, sacks, and key plays that have changed games. His return in 2026 is expected to strengthen the Packers’ defense significantly.

    Team coaches have highlighted Parsons’ professionalism and dedication. They have praised his commitment to recovery and his leadership qualities, which extend beyond the field. The linebacker’s attitude sets an example for younger players and underscores his role as a cornerstone of the team.

    Medical experts stress that successful ACL surgery is only the first step. Recovery depends on disciplined rehabilitation, consistent therapy sessions, and a gradual return to high-intensity workouts. Parsons’ positive update indicates that he is on track, but careful monitoring will continue in the months ahead.

    Fans have responded with support and encouragement. Social media posts have flooded in, wishing Parsons a smooth recovery and expressing excitement for his return. Many highlight his impact on the Packers’ defensive lineup and the difference his presence makes on the field.

    Looking ahead, Micah Parsons’ return in 2026 could be a game-changer for the Packers. Analysts expect him to resume his role as a leading linebacker, contributing to both pass rush and run defense. His recovery progress will be closely followed by fans and commentators throughout the offseason.

    With the successful surgery behind him, Parsons is focusing on the next steps. The linebacker’s determination, combined with professional medical care, gives the Green Bay Packers confidence that he will return stronger than ever. His update serves as a reminder of the resilience and dedication required to overcome serious sports injuries.
